How Cayuga Onondaga BOCES-Practical Nursing Program Compares

Retention at Cayuga Onondaga BOCES-Practical Nursing Program runs at 60%, fairly typical for the trade-college space. The 11:1 student-faculty ratio suggests an institution operating at familiar academic-quality benchmarks rather than pushing them.

Understanding Academic Quality Metrics

Student-Faculty Ratio: A ratio of 11:1 means there are approximately 11 students for every faculty member. This low ratio typically allows for more individualized attention and smaller class sizes.

Retention Rates: These show the percentage of students who return for their second year. Higher retention rates typically indicate student satisfaction, academic support, and program quality.

How Intensively Do Students Study at Cayuga Onondaga BOCES-Practical Nursing Program?

Student Enrollment Intensity

The Full-Time Equivalent (FTE) ratio shows the average course load intensity. An FTE ratio of 1.0 means all students attend full-time, while lower values indicate more part-time enrollment.

90.6%
FTE Ratio
Intensity LevelHigh

Most students maintain full-time or near-full-time course loads, balancing academics with limited outside commitments.
